I have a SD4A425DB-HNY PTZ (the mini PTX with a dome). I set up a preset to look at a bird feeder, and every time it goes there it autofocuses on tree branches behind the feeder, leaving what I want to see blurry. I can "fix" this by disabling auto focus on the camera, then every time I manually move the camera to a new spot, I have to do manual focus. Is there a way to shut off autofocus for one preset only? I tried Near Focus Limit. No help from that.
 
That's funny, I have the EXACT same problem. Same camera, same target that hoses the autofocus. I ended up setting a bunch of other focused presets with autofocus off, but of course whenever I leave those it's a problem. I scoured the forum and the net at large trying to find an API call that would kick in autofocus, but no luck (which is strange, because there's an autofocus button in the interface that will do that).
